<p>ASHBURN - After being unavailable to the media on Monday, Redskins quarterback Rex Grossman spoke to reporters on Wednesday for the first time since being named the starter.</p>
<p>Grossman won what was a "close" competition according to head coach Mike Shanahan. Most believed Grossman's counterpart, fifth year man John Beck, would get the nod come Week 1 against the Giants, but Shanahan went with who he thought had the better preseason with Grossman.</p>
<p>Not surprisingly, Grossman expressed his confidence in ability to win the job.</p>
<p></p>
<p class="MsoNormal">"Throughout this whole thing I wanted to play well, and have no regrets about my play." he said. "My confidence would waiver a little bit every once in a while, and [I] wasn’t real sure what they were going to do [with the decision], but I wanted to play well, and I felt real good about how well I played in the preseason games and in practice."</p>
<p>One issue that was evident during the competition was how "fair" the competition was. Experts and pundits believed that Shanahan wanted Beck to win the job, and would give him every opportunity to win it. However, Grossman still won out, and believed Shanahan was fair during the entire process.</p>
<p></p>
<p>"There's been times in the past," he recalled. "Where you can't quite trust what [the coaching staff] were actually saying. But I have a pretty good relationship with Kyle [Shanahan] and Mike's a stand-up guy, so I took them at their word, and I trusted it. "</p>
<p>This Sunday's start will be Grossman's first Week 1 start since the 2007 season, completing what has been a long road back to being a fulltime starter, which is what he was with the Chicago Bears. </p>
<p>"I didn't take [the starting job] for granted, in Chicago," Grossman said."But anytime something gets taken away from you, and you get it back, you have a different outlook [and] a different type of approach and respect to the position you're in."</p>
<p>Indeed, this represents a second chance for Grossman, who has been ridiculed for his inconsistent style of play so far in his career. But with Washington, he sees a new opportunity to prove his doubters wrong, and help the Redskins in the process.</p>
<p></p>
<p class="MsoNormal">"To be the starting quarterback of the Washington Redskins is a huge thing," the ninth year pro said. "I fully understand it, and it’s my goal to take it and run with it. It’s a very exciting time for me, and I feel great about it."</p>

<p class="MsoNormal">ASHBURN - After practice Redskins head coach Mike Shanahan addressed reporters for the first time since making a decision on his Week 1 starting quarterback. </p>
<p class="MsoNormal">Here's a transcript of what followed:</p>
<p class="MsoNormal"><b>The announcement of QB:</b> “I had a chance to talk to our quarterbacks over the weekend. I talked to both John and Rex. [It was] a very good battle. Like I’ve said all along, I’ve got a lot of faith in both of them. It’s been very competitive all the way through. I wanted to announce it today that starting quarterback will be, obviously, Rex. The rumors are right”</p>
<p class="MsoNormal"><b>On what went into the decision:</b> “[It was] Day by day. Practice everyday, game situations. Just watching [both of them], how they perform in all different areas. It was close. Very competitive. As I’ve said, I’ve got a lot of confidence in both guys after watching them through this camp.”</p>
<p class="MsoNormal"><b>On why he chose to announce it on Monday:</b> “I just thought it was the best thing. If we knew what direction we were going to go, [we wanted] to let everybody know and let everybody know [as soon as possible] so on Wednesday we can focus on the Giants and not all the speculation that goes on in between. I wanted to take as long as I possibly could to make sure that I did make the right decision. But [it] was very competitive, and I like where we’re at.”</p>
<p class="MsoNormal"><b>On Rex’s preseason:</b> ”Like I said, you’re looking at him everyday. Everything he does. It’s a big evaluation process. [We look at] 7-on-7 [drills], check-offs, audibles, blitzes. All in all, I thought he did a great job. I thought John did too. But I thought Rex won by an inch.”</p>
<p class="MsoNormal"><b>On Rex having regular season snaps in this offense:</b> “First of all, it’s always nice to get some snaps. familiar with the system. I thought he was pretty automatic with a lot of his reads. Hopefully he plays accordingly.”</p>
<p class="MsoNormal"><b>On if there was something John Beck didn’t show him:</b> “John did a great job, too. [It] was very close.”</p>
<p class="MsoNormal"><b>On how much past experience helped Rex:</b> " I’ve said from day one, anytime you’ve got confidence in two quarterbacks, it’s pretty good in the National Football League, and that’s what I have right now. It’s going to be fun. It’s going to be fun now that we can get going and we got two quarterbacks that we got a lot of confidence in, and hopefully they play accordingly” <span> </span></p>
<p class="MsoNormal"><b>On if he will re-evaluate the QB position after the Giants game:</b> “We evaluate every position. That’s the nature of this game. You’ve got to be at the top of your game to stay at any position. I know that everybody wants to make the quarterback controversy and [say] ‘How long will he be here?’, just like any position. It’s the nature of the game. You’ve got to perform [even] if you’re a Pro Bowl player, or you’re coming in as a first round draft choice, [or] a third round draft choice. We’re going to evaluate you everyday. And I told [the two quarterbacks] from the start, I said ‘I have no idea what direction we’re going to go. Whoever plays the best is going to start’”</p>
<p class="MsoNormal"><b>On if Rex Grossman is the starter for the entire season:</b> “Obviously you make your decision based for the season.”</p>
<p class="MsoNormal"><b>On if it is Rex Grossman’s job to lose:</b> “Of course it is. When you pick a guy out, you don’t say ‘Hey, do you think this guy is going to fail?’. Obviously you’re hoping he’d be very successful.”</p>
<p class="MsoNormal"><b>On John Beck’s reaction to the decision:</b> “I think the same way Rex would [have]. These guys are very competitive. Whichever way we went, obviously the other guy would be disappointed. But they’re going to support their teammates. He’s one play away from being the starter. I’ve got a lot of confidence in him. ”</p>

<p><span>Rex Grossman</span> will soon be named the <a class="sbn-auto-link" href="http://www.sbnation.com/nfl/teams/washington-redskins">Washington Redskins</a>' starting quarterback for Week 1 against the <a class="sbn-auto-link" href="https://www.bigblueview.com/">New York Giants</a>, <a href="http://blogs.nfl.com/2011/09/05/redskins-say-grossman-will-be-week-1-starter/">according to a report by Jason La Canfora of NFL Network</a>. It remains unclear exactly why Redskins coach Mike Shanahan has picked Grossman instead of <span>John Beck</span>, who he has been high on all winter, but one reason is their preseason performance.</p>
<p>Both quarterbacks certainly had their moments, but Grossman seemed to get the better of Beck after looking at the numbers. Grossman completed 34 of 53 passes for 407 yards, two touchdowns, one interception and a 92.3 quarterback rating, while Beck was 30 of 48 for 356 yards, one touchdown, two interceptions and a 74.7 rating. By the numbers, that makes Grossman the clear winner.</p>
<p>In other words, Grossman's preseason probably won him the job. <p>It appears the answer to the Redskins' quarterback quandary has been solved, for now. According to a report, Rex Grossman will be the Week 1 starter against the Giants. </p> <p>All summer, <a class="sbn-auto-link" href="http://www.sbnation.com/nfl/teams/washington-redskins">Redskins</a> fans have pondered the answer to the team's biggest question - who's going to the be the Week 1 starting quarterback? It appears the answer to that mystery has now been revealed. <a href="http://blogs.nfl.com/2011/09/05/redskins-say-grossman-will-be-week-1-starter/">According to NFL Network's Jason La Canfora</a>, the Redskins have decided to go with nine-year veteran <span>Rex Grossman</span>. </p>
<p>The move itself is not a surprise, as Grossman started the team's third preseason game - considered by most to be the dress rehearsal - against the <a class="sbn-auto-link" href="https://www.baltimorebeatdown.com/">Baltimore Ravens</a>. He was then rested in the preseason finale against the <a class="sbn-auto-link" href="https://www.bucsnation.com/">Tampa Bay Buccaneers</a>, which seemed to suggest that he was considered the starter all along. </p>
<p>What is a surprise is the fact that Shanahan's decision has come out this early in the week. It was expected by many that news of the team's starter would come out Wednesday, at the earliest. But instead it has been leaked during the team's early preparations for the <a class="sbn-auto-link" href="https://www.bigblueview.com/">New York Giants</a>.</p>
<p>Grossman finished the preseason with 64 percent completion percentage, threw for two touchdowns and one interception, with a 92.3 quarterback rating.</p>
